Mission Wealth Management LP Increases Holdings in Nokia Oyj (NYSE:NOK)

Mission Wealth Management LP increased its position in Nokia Oyj (NYSE:NOKFree Report) by 12.5%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the SEC. The fund owned 88,474 shares of the technology company’s stock after acquiring an additional 9,800 shares during the quarter. Mission Wealth Management LP’s holdings in Nokia Oyj were worth $392,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Other large investors also recently added to or reduced their stakes in the company. QRG Capital Management Inc. increased its holdings in Nokia Oyj by 29.9% in the 4th quarter. QRG Capital Management Inc. now owns 690,657 shares of the technology company’s stock worth $3,060,000 after acquiring an additional 158,935 shares during the last quarter. FMR LLC increased its holdings in Nokia Oyj by 1,012.3% in the 3rd quarter. FMR LLC now owns 30,497,275 shares of the technology company’s stock worth $133,273,000 after acquiring an additional 27,755,460 shares during the last quarter. XTX Topco Ltd bought a new position in Nokia Oyj in the 3rd quarter worth about $1,417,000.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C boosted its stake in Nokia Oyj by 14.5% in the 4th quarter.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C now owns 50,428 shares of the technology company’s stock worth $226,000 after purchasing an additional 6,395 shares during the period. Finally, Atria Wealth Solutions Inc. boosted its stake in Nokia Oyj by 261.4% in the 4th quarter. Atria Wealth Solutions Inc. now owns 103,069 shares of the technology company’s stock worth $457,000 after purchasing an additional 74,552 shares during the period. Hedge funds and other institutional investors own 5.28% of the company’s stock.

Wall Street Analyst Weigh In

Several research analysts have commented on NOK shares. JPMorgan Chase & Co. cut their target price on Nokia Oyj from $6.35 to $6.30 and set an “overweight” rating for the company in a research note on Friday, February 21st. Craig Hallum raised their target price on Nokia Oyj from $6.00 to $7.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research note on Monday, January 6th. StockNews.com downgraded Nokia Oyj from a “strong-buy” rating to a “buy” rating in a research note on Monday, February 3rd. Finally, The Goldman Sachs Group downgraded Nokia Oyj from a “neutral” rating to a “sell” rating and set a $3.60 price target for the company. in a research report on Thursday, January 16th. One research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ating and five have assigned a buy r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at, Nokia Oyj has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average price target of $5.85.

Nokia Oyj Stock Performance

Shares of NOK opened at $5.18 on Thursday. The company has a market cap of $28.22 billion, a PE ratio of 20.70,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 6.43 and a beta of 1.11. The company has a current ratio of 1.58, a quick ratio of 1.39 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.14. The stock has a 50-day moving average price of $4.70 and a 200-day moving average price of $4.50. Nokia Oyj has a 12-month low of $3.29 and a 12-month high of $5.18.

Nokia Oyj (NYSE:NOKG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, January 30th. The technology company reported $0.19 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.14 by $0.05. Nokia Oyj had a return on equity of 10.30% and a net margin of 6.54%. As a group, equities analysts forecast that Nokia Oyj will post 0.34 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Nokia Oyj Company Profile

Nokia Oyj provides mobile, fixed, and cloud network solutions worldwide. The company operates through four segments: Network Infrastructure, Mobile Networks, Cloud and Network Services, and Nokia Technologies. The company provides fixed networking solutions, such as fiber and copper-based access infrastructure, in-home Wi-Fi solutions, and cloud and virtualization services; IP networking solutions, including IP access, aggregation, and edge and core routing for residential, mobile, enterprise and cloud applications; optical networks solutions that provides optical transport networks for metro, regional, and long-haul applications, and subsea applications; and submarine networks for undersea cable transmission.
